The LeFevre Quartet announced former Gold City tenor Jay Parrack and former Anchormen/Driven/Dixie Melody Boys bass singer Will Lane are joining the group. They replace the departing Jeremy Peace and Keith Plott who are making their final appearances with the group this weekend.

Jeremy Peace announced he submitted his resignation to Mike and Jordan LeFevre in mid-September. He plans to focus on his new recording studio business and will assist the LeFevre Quartet behind the scenes.

Keith Plott announced he submitted his resignation to the LeFevre Quartet last month. Plott plans to continue touring as a solo artist. All three parties emphasized the upcoming changes to the LeFevre Quartet have been made on good terms.

The National Quartet Convention announced they will not offer a webcast in 2020. Changes in federal copyright law, specifically the Music Modernization Act, were cited as the reason for their decision.
